Wall Mirror Wall

A wall mirror wall refers to the use of one or multiple wall-mounted mirrors arranged across a wall surface to enhance light, depth, and visual impact within an interior. This approach may involve a single large mirror or a coordinated grouping of mirrors to create a feature wall. For trade buyers, mirror walls provide a practical and design-led solution that improves spatial perception while maintaining consistency across commercial and residential projects.

How It’s Used in Commercial & Trade Interiors
Wall mirror walls are commonly specified in hotels, restaurants, show homes, residential developments, gyms, and retail environments. In hospitality and reception areas, they help create a sense of openness and reflect lighting schemes, while in corridors and smaller rooms they visually expand the space. Trade buyers value mirror walls for their scalability across multiple rooms or properties, with consistent sizing and finishes supporting uniform installations. Predictable lead times and suitability for bulk specification are key advantages in large-scale projects.

Materials, Design & Build Quality
Mirror walls typically use high-quality glass panels with safety backing, supported by secure wall fixings suitable for commercial environments. Frames may be minimal or decorative, using materials such as metal or wood, depending on the desired aesthetic. Build quality focuses on durability, precise alignment, and long-term stability, particularly in high-traffic areas. Consistent finishes and accurate dimensions are essential for trade buyers specifying mirror walls across multiple locations.
